Transaction 0047072805226753011a250def0158d67668f2d20f5af6d024f55b68bb360c92
1 Input
2 Outputs
- 0047072805226753011a250def0158d67668f2d20f5af6d024f55b68bb360c92:0
- 0047072805226753011a250def0158d67668f2d20f5af6d024f55b68bb360c92:1
value 10751
address 1423Aeq4MW6MCySf9AgkqD8iS8C83Xh1AZ
value 4288284
address 15MMX6rM3u4xjPbd2J6dZek6kKgiPwKExB